软件架构主要有C/S和B/S两种模式,本文重点探讨B/S架构的设计思路与实现方法,旨在为开发者提供实用参考,欢迎阅读并支持。
1、 第一步
2、 B/S模式即浏览器与服务器交互的架构,相较于C/S模式,具有维护简便、跨平台性强、无需安装客户端等优势。
3、 B/S模式支持在线更新,用户无需频繁升级客户端。
4、 第二步
5、 采用B/S架构,以服务端搭建为主,通常在访问量较小时,仅需一台服务器即可满足需求。
6、 第三步
7、 当网页需存储客户资料、订单等信息时,必须通过服务器端操作数据库进行数据的添加或删除。
8、 第四步
9、 客户较多时需进行负载均衡,可采用F5或Nginx实现。
10、 第五步
11、 数据库负载过高时,应搭建集群以分担压力、提升性能和可用性。
